One notable book that delves into the relationship between religion and society is "Sapiens: A Brief History of Humankind" by Yuval Noah Harari. This acclaimed work explores the role of religion in shaping human history and societal structures. By tracing the evolution of belief systems and the impact of religious ideologies on human civilization, Harari offers a profound reflection on the connection between religion and society. On the documentary front, "The Story of God with Morgan Freeman" provides a captivating exploration of various religious beliefs and their influence on societies worldwide. Through engaging storytelling and insightful interviews, the series examines the diverse ways in which religion intersects with social, cultural, and political landscapes.
